Hawaiian Roll French Toast: A Delicious Twist with Turkey Bacon

Indulge in a delightful breakfast with Hawaiian Roll French Toast, perfectly paired with crispy turkey bacon.

-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
- Total Time: 25 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ings

- 6 Hawaiian rolls
- 4 large eggs
- 1 cup milk
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 4 slices turkey bacon
- 1 tablespoon butter
- Maple syrup for serving
- In a large b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, vanilla extract, ground cinnamon, and salt.
- Slice the Hawaiian rolls in half and soak them in the egg mixture for a few minutes until well-coated.
- In a skillet, cook the turkey bacon until crispy. Remove and set aside.
- In the same skillet, melt the butter over medium heat.
- Add the soaked Hawaiian rolls to the skillet and cook until golden brown on both sides.
- Serve warm with turkey bacon and drizzle with maple syrup.
Notes
- For a sweeter version, sprinkle powdered sugar on top before serving.
- Feel free to add fresh fruit as a topping for added flavor.
